Grainger has an employee rating of 4.0 out of 5 stars, based on 4,997 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Grainger employ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.4 stars).

Pros

-Decent pay and benefits thats about it and a great staff discount , Oh wait ! Sorry they took that away.

Cons

-I was bullied and harassed for doing my job - No training system in place at all -ALOT of veteran employees that are too set in there ways, loopy, ornery, have poor communication, are abusive ,and are not team players. -You well never get a full vacation, you have to split your weeks up, one here one there and even then when it gets approved they can turn around and deny you. -You will commute long distances to workplace, even though they will tell you that the like to put you close by in a branch near you. -Constant shuffling of branch managers - Grossly understaffed , not enough people to handle the work load at times - Antiquated paper system that is so error prone that all you can do is laugh -I was told I got paid too much for what did, wow thanks for your encouragement.
